Recently I've had some artifact issues in games, they seem to go on/off and I have been waiting to RMA my video card. Yesterday the power in the house went out completely, then flickered, then came back on ~10 mins later.
I booted up my PC and ran into "Data in EC or EC Flash might be corrupted" while trying to boot. I reset the CMOS and went straight into BIOS. Set my drives back up to RAID (it defaults ATA I think) and booted. Since then, I've been getting errors everywhere. From Explorer crashing (not IE, just Explorer) recursively, Skype, League of Legends, Chrome, etc. I have had multiple BSOD's since then with 'memory management' errors. I've also had one instance of literally no programs running because 'Unable to find entry point' something or other.
Windows 7 64-bit
Asus DirectCU II GTX 580 (was OC'd, is now underclocked due to above artifact issues)
Asus P8P67 LE
2500k @ 4.3 Ghz
2x4GB DDR3 (Corsair something... can't remember series), set to 1600 in BIOS
650W Antec Earthwatts PSU (possibly 750W)
7x74 GB Raptors in Raid 0 (Windows/Programs) SATA (no RAID card)
1TB WD (storage) SATA
If anyone has any ideas on how I can isolate what the cause is, it would be very appreciated. If you need any more info just ask. Computer was hooked up to a power bar, not sure of the specs of it. I believe it has some type of surge protection, it's fairly heavy duty (and I think that's why I bought it).
